Sierra Leone edged Liberia 1-0 in this international friendly, with the deciding strike arriving in the second half at 01:06:42. The home side picked up two yellow cards across the match, the first in the opening minutes of the game and a second late in the second half, while Liberia finished without a booking. There were three corners apiece, and no red cards were shown.

The sprint to create goals came with equal corner activity on both sides, showing a balanced approach to set-piece opportunities. Sierra Leone’s six offsides suggests they were prepared to push high and test the line, while Liberia’s solitary offside implies a more conservative timing in their attacks.

Fouls were close, with Sierra Leone committing eight and Liberia nine, indicating a slightly more aggressive approach from the home team but not enough to tilt the balance on discipline. The absence of red cards and the single-goal margin point to a tightly managed contest, where both sides kept a controlled defensive shape for large periods.

Defensively, Sierra Leone maintained a clean sheet after the interval, demonstrating compact organization and resilience to Liberia’s attempts to level the tie. Without data on shots on target or goalkeeper saves, it’s difficult to quantify shot-stopping quality, but the final scoreline reflects effective defense and disciplined occupancy of crucial zones.

Attacking intent appears to have been high for Sierra Leone, evidenced by the high offside tally even after taking the lead, though the decisive goal came from open play rather than a set-piece. The equal corner counts confirm no clear advantage from dead-ball situations on the day, suggesting the winner was earned through dynamic forward runs and organized pressing rather than sustained set-piece pressure.
